Memphis CLI must be installed separately. ### Step 1: Install Memphis CLI (4 min) ```bash # Option 1: One-liner (RECOMMENDED) curl -fsSL https://raw.githubusercontent.com/elathoxu-crypto/memphis/main/install.sh | bash # Option 2: Manual git clone https://github.com/elathoxu-crypto/memphis.git ~/memphis cd ~/memphis npm install && npm run build npm link # Or: npm run install-global # Option 3: From npm (when published) npm install -g @elathoxu-crypto/memphis ``` ### Step 2: Install ClawHub Skill (1 min) ```bash clawhub install memphis-cognitive ``` ### Step 3: Initialize (30 sec) ```bash memphis init # Interactive setup wizard ``` โ **Done!** Memphis is ready! ๐ --- ## ๐ Quick Start (5 minutes) ### 1. First Decision (30 sec) ```bash memphis decide "Use TypeScript" "TypeScript" -r "Better type safety" ``` ### 2. Ask Memory (30 sec) ```bash memphis ask "Why did I choose TypeScript?" ``` ### 3. Search Memory (30 sec) ```bash memphis recall "typescript" ``` ### 4. Advanced: Knowledge Graph (30 sec) ```bash memphis graph build --limit 50 memphis graph show --stats ``` ### 5. Advanced: Reflection (30 sec) ```bash memphis reflect --daily ``` โ **Memory system operational!** --- ## ๐ง The 3 Cognitive Models ### Model A: Conscious Decisions (Manual) **Speed:** 92ms average (frictionless capture) ```bash # Full syntax memphis decide "Database choice" "PostgreSQL" \ -r "Better JSON support" \ -t tech,backend \ --scope project # Frictionless (92ms) memphis decide-fast "use TypeScript" ``` --- ### Model B: Inferred Decisions (Automatic) **Accuracy:** 50-83% confidence ```bash # Analyze last 30 days memphis infer --since 30 # Interactive mode memphis infer --prompt --since 7 ``` --- ### Model C: Predictive Decisions (Predictive) **Accuracy:** 78% average (improves over time) ```bash # Learn patterns (one-time setup, needs 50+ decisions) memphis predict --learn --since 90 # Get predictions memphis predict # Proactive suggestions memphis suggest --force # Track accuracy memphis accuracy ``` --- ## ๐ Advanced Features (v3.6.2) ### 1. TUI Dashboard **Interactive terminal UI for monitoring** ```bash memphis tui ``` **Features:** - Real-time chain monitoring - Visual block explorer - Dashboard statistics --- ### 2. Knowledge Graph **Visualize knowledge connections** ```bash # Build graph memphis graph build --limit 50 # Show statistics memphis graph show --stats # Filter by chain memphis graph show --chain journal --depth 2 ``` **Performance:** 50 nodes, 1778 edges in 36ms โ --- ### 3. Reflection Engine **Generate insights from memory** ```bash # Daily reflection (last 24h) memphis reflect --daily # Weekly reflection (last 7 days) memphis reflect --weekly # Deep dive (last 30 days) memphis reflect --deep # Save to journal memphis reflect --weekly --save ``` **Features:** - Automatic pattern detection - Curiosity tracking - Recurring concept identification - Knowledge graph clusters **Performance:** 46ms for 179 entries โ --- ### 4. Trade Protocol **Multi-agent knowledge exchange** ```bash # Create trade manifest memphis trade create "did:memphis:recipient-123" \ --blocks journal:100-110 \ --ttl 7 \ --out /tmp/trade.json # Verify signature memphis trade verify /tmp/trade.json # Accept trade memphis trade accept /tmp/trade.json # List pending offers memphis trade list ``` **Features:** - DID-based identity - Cryptographic signatures - TTL (time-to-live) support - Usage rights specification --- ### 5. Multi-Agent Sync **Synchronize between Memphis instances** ```bash # Check sync status memphis share-sync --status # Push local blocks to remote memphis share-sync --push # Pull remote blocks to local memphis share-sync --pull # Custom remote memphis share-sync --push --remote 10.0.0.80 --user memphis ``` **Performance:** 18 blocks synced in 0.81s โ --- ### 6.
